RelayCast: A Middleware for Application-level Multicast Services
Application-level multicast (ALM) is being increasingly recognized as a solution to support multipoint applications without the need for a network layer multicast protocol. Though several ALM systems have been proposed, all the multicast functions are independently developed and integrated into individual applications. However, we can find out the common functions of ALM among the existing sysr goal is to abstract the common functions and incorporate them in the middleware called RelayCast. RelayCast meets the fundamental requirements of various applications by combining several components of ALM functions. In this paper, we firstly present the architecture and implementation of RelayCast. Then, we present the multipath routing mechanism as a component. The multi-path routing achieves fast tree rebuilding at the time of tree partition caused by end-host’s leave or failure.
